State marine fossil. Tylosaurus, a giant mosasaur which inhabited the great inland sea that covered portions of Kansas during the cretaceous period of the mesozoic era and grew to lengths of more than 40 feet, is hereby designated as the official marine fossil of the state of Kansas. 73-3401. The new museum is a wonderful mixture of the many spectacular (and unique) exhibits that were once housed in McCartney Hall on the campus of Fort Hays State University, and many new, state-of-the-art re-creations of prehistoric life.Silvisaurus was a plant-eating dinosaur with hard-plate body armor. It belongs to a family of herbivore, armored dinosaurs known as nodosaurs. Then, in the fall ...Mar 8, 2014 · LEFT: The skull of the ankylosaur Silvisaurus condrayi (KUVP 10296) from the Dakota Sandstone (middle Cenomanian) of Ottawa County, Kansas (north of Salina, KS) in July, 1955. This is the most complete skull of a dinosaur ever found in Kansas. It was described and named by T.H. Eaton, Jr. in 1960. Sinclair gas stations with these Dinosaur statues are common in Colorado. One question I had, “Is this dinosaur pronounced differently in Arkansas vs. Kansas?” Along the trail, there was a live show going on led by one of their expedition team members.Kansas heritage to recognize Silvisaurus condrayi as proposed here today. Silvisaurus represents the only known dinosaur from the Dakota Formation in KS. It is an armored dinosaur, with a body covering of spikes and plates. The skull and much of the skeleton were recovered making it one of the most unique and significant fossils of its kind.Joyland Amusement Park - Kansas; Dinosaur World - Arkansas; Related Articles.
